自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(26)
  • 资源 (1)
  • 收藏
  • 关注

原创 cass的顺序。。。

http://planetcassandra.org/blog/we-shall-have-order/

2015-05-22 14:10:02 1324

原创 windows安装paramiko

1.环境win7 64位python 2.7.92.按照某篇博客安装http://laocao.blog.51cto.com/480714/525667依次安装MinGW,pycrypto,paramiko。博客中提到安装好mingw后,需要在Python安装目录下的Lib\distutils\文件夹里建立一个distutils.cfg文件,文件内容为:

2015-05-18 16:06:16 1308

原创 Cassandra的timestamp类型

cqlsh:testspace> CREATE TABLE test_timestamp(id int, date timestamp, PRIMARY KEY(id,date));cqlsh:testspace> INSERT INTO test_timestamp (id, date ) VALUES ( 1,'2015-05-18 09:00');cqlsh:testspace> I

2015-05-18 10:50:53 9010

原创 TinyXML 加载XML

1.从XML文件加载

2014-07-17 09:02:39 658

转载 Ubuntu下打开文件乱码及编码转换

txt文件在Windows下可以正常显示,Ubuntu下打开文件乱码。这是中文编码问题,Windows下用的是gb2312,而linux下用的是utf8。在此提供5种解决方案:1. 在文档所在目录运行命令     iconv -f gb2312 -t utf8 -c 1.txt > 2.txt 选项-c的作用是忽略不能识别的字符,继续向后转换。否则iconv遇到不能识别的字符就终止

2014-01-03 17:02:05 853

原创 读书笔记<1>——指令:计算机的语言

1、MIPS 指令字段R型:op(6)+rs(5)+rt(5)+rd(5)+shamt(5)+funct(6)   一般指令I 型:op(6)+rs(5)+rt(5)+constant/address(16)         lw sw等J型:op(6)+add(26)                                                      跳转指令J

2013-09-22 19:48:02 758

转载 eclipse、android开发 logcat出现 Unable to open log device ‘/dev/log/main’: No such file or directory 解决办法

在我们使用真机进行Android应用调试时,无法获得调试信息,错误提示如下:Unable to open log device ‘/dev/log/main’: No such file or directory这是因为我们的手机没有开起log记录,下面以华为U8860为例开启手机的log功能:5、重启

2013-09-13 02:53:16 3281

转载 中央气象台 API接口(json格式)

1. 数据接口http://www.weather.com.cn/data/sk/101010100.htmlhttp://www.weather.com.cn/data/cityinfo/101010100.htmlhttp://m.weather.com.cn/data/101010100.html2. 图片接口http://m.weather.com.cn

2013-09-13 01:27:37 2694

原创 eclipse adb问题

run On device 时又如下问题The connection to adb is down, and a severe error has occured.按照所查操作提示----------------------------------------1.先把eclipse关闭.2.在管理器转到你的android SDK 的platform-tools下, 如

2013-09-13 01:15:38 722

原创 使用微信开放平台遇到的问题

首先微信开放平台FAQ有这么一段Q:为什么用网上下载的SDK Demo工程直接运行到设备上,一开始可以正常调试,后面就不可以?A:这里是由于身份校验失败造成的,要运行SDK Demo工程,可以参考文档《如何运行SDK Demo工程》,同时请下载更新最新版的SDK Sample。注意了,一开始可以正常调试,后面就不可以了。而我前后折腾如下:手机A始终连不上网,手机B可以1

2013-09-11 15:48:32 1356

转载 AndroidManifest.xml

一、关于AndroidManifest.xmlAndroidManifest.xml 是每个android程序中必须的文件。它位于整个项目的根目录,描述了package中暴露的组件(activities, services, 等等),他们各自的实现类,各种能被处理的数据和启动位置。 除了能声明程序中的Activities, ContentProviders, Services, 和Inte

2013-09-09 12:06:00 485

原创 Run Android Application on device

1、对于不同的手机,要安装对应的USB Driverhttp://developer.android.com/tools/extras/oem-usb.html不过我在华为的链接里面没找到C8812的机型,于是用360手机助手安装了驱动。。。2、run configurations里面选择 target。有时会找不到你的项目,所以我会在项目名上右键。选择 automatically

2013-09-08 21:36:55 591

转载 Android SDK Manager 下载问题

自己在开发的时候,用SDK Manager下载samples有些问题,简单办法就是单独下载Android 4.3 samples for SDK,链接如下:http://dl-ssl.google.com/android/repository/samples-18_r01.zip  类似的可以参见:http://www.hariadi.org/android/manual-do

2013-09-08 20:50:47 2344

原创 地址翻译:从虚拟地址到物理地址

1.名词释义----------------------------------VA:虚拟地址PA:物理地址VM:虚拟存储器MMU:存储管理单元VP:虚拟页 VM被组织为存放在磁盘上的N个连续的字节大小的单元组成的数组。每个字节都有唯一的虚拟地址。磁盘上数组的内容被缓存到主存中,磁盘上的数据被分割为块,即虚拟页VP,作为磁盘和主存之间的传输单元。类似的,物理存储器被

2013-09-05 23:21:11 2314

原创 异常

1.异常处理系统中可能的每种异常均有对应的代号。系统启动时,操作系统分配和初始化一张称为异常表的跳转表,使得条目k包含异常k的处理程序的地址。异常表的起始地址放在一个叫做异常表址寄存器的特殊寄存器中。异常类似与过程调用,但是有一些不同的地方。1.根据异常的类型,处理器记录的返回地址可能是当前指令,也可能是下一条指令的。2.处理器也会把一些额外的处理器状态压到栈里,因为重

2013-09-05 22:13:33 647

原创 从ASCII码源文件到可执行目标文件

/*main.c*/void swap();int buf[2]={1,2};int main(){ swap(); return 0;}/*swap.c*/extern int buf[];int *bufp0=&buf[0];int *bufp1;void swap(){ int temp; b

2013-09-05 21:14:41 865

原创 Windows下编辑的txt在linux下乱码的解决办法

linux下用的编码一般是utf-8,windows下一般是gb2312使用命令iconv -f gb2312 -t utf-8 a.txt>newa.txt,就可以生成正常显示的文件newa.txt

2013-09-01 23:24:37 753

转载 HashMap与Hashtable的区别

HashTable的应用非常广泛,HashMap是新框架中用来代替HashTable的类,也就是说建议使用HashMap,不要使用HashTable。可能你觉得HashTable很好用,为什么不用呢?这里简单分析他们的区别。1.HashTable的方法是同步的,HashMap未经同步,所以在多线程场合要手动同步HashMap这个区别就像Vector和ArrayList一样。2.Ha

2013-09-01 18:33:42 508

原创 Java String相关

1、运算符‘+’的扩展+运算符除了能进行String的连接,还能将字符串和其他类型的数据进行连接,结果是字符串如果‘+’运算符的第一个操作数是字符串,则Java系统会自动将后续的操作数类型转换成字符串操作,然后连接;如果‘+’运算符的第一个操作数不是字符串,则运算结果依据后续的操作数决定因此有,3+4+5+"abc"=“12abc”2、String的equals()和equ

2013-09-01 14:22:17 591

转载 java的HashCode方法

有许多人学了很长时间的Java,但一直不明白hashCode方法的作用,我来解释一下吧。首先,想要明白hashCode的作用,你必须要先知道Java中的集合。   总的来说,Java中的集合(Collection)有两类,一类是List,再有一类是Set。 你知道它们的区别吗?前者集合内的元素是有序的,元素可以重复;后者元素无序,但元素不可重复。 那么这里就有一个比较严重的问题

2013-09-01 14:00:34 606

原创 java异常处理

1、public class ThrowsException {static void demo(){throw new NullPointerException("demo");//运行时错误}public static void main(String args[]){demo();System.out.println("fdjsalfjdls");

2013-08-31 14:53:56 639

原创 apk

一、反编译得到java源代码1、下载dex2jar最新版本,解压至你想要的目录,并添加至环境变量。2、下载jd-gui(绿色版,解压后jd-gui.exe可直接运行,用于查看jar文件中的源代码)3、使用:将apk改后缀为.zip并解压,找到classes.dex。打开cmd,输入>dex2jar.bat classes.dex,较新的版本为d2j-dex2jar.bat clas

2013-08-28 11:25:34 737

转载 eclipse生成jar包

第一:普通类导出jar包,我说的普通类就是指此类包含main方法,并且没有用到别的jar包。 1.在eclipse中选择你要导出的类或者package,右击,选择Export子选项; 2.在弹出的对话框中,选择java文件---选择JAR file,单击next; 3.在JAR file后面的文本框中选择你要生成的jar包的位置以及名字,注意在Export generate

2013-08-27 17:50:25 523

原创 Java I/O

1、写入记事本换行的问题使用FileWriter写入记事本文件时,比如out.write("Hello!\n"),可是打开记事本时通常显示的比较错乱可是将记事本用notepad打开时就能正常显示换行。添加相应的System.out.print("Hello!\n")语句,则在命令行中显示也是没有问题的。解决办法:使用BufferedWriter out=new BufferedWr

2013-08-25 16:19:06 511

原创 tomcat 404错误 端口8080等被占用

每次在eclipse中运行webapptomcat老是404错误,显示端口8080,8005,8009等都被占用cmd中用命令netstat -ano查看占用端口进程的PID然后 任务管理器-查看-查看列-勾选PID 后可以看到javaw.exe占用了这几个端口关闭该进程后,重新启动eclipse,再运行还是不可以,再次查看任务管理器,javaw.exe又被占用百度百科表示C:

2013-08-14 13:51:12 1351 1

原创 几个有用的链接网址

Apache Tomcat下载:http://tomcat.apache.org/download-80.cgi

2013-08-12 22:45:13 1190

80x86编程手册

80x86编程手册 英文版的 看起来有点费劲

2013-08-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除